steve68 Posted September 20, 2023 Share Posted September 20, 2023 2002 R1150R 50K miles So I have an electrical popping sound that occurs when I start the bike. It never seems to happen on a cold start, only after I have ridden for a bit, stopped and restarted. I hit the starter button and while it's revving up I hear a single loud pop/click sound. Around 2 months ago I got a new battery. Since then, the sound is accompanied by a bit of electrically-smelling light smoke . Then the bike runs great. Have not pulled the tank yet, but obviously is the next step. I am not electrically inclined but would guess that there is some sort of current bridging going on during the higher curretn/voltage starting process. Thoughts? Steven Link to comment

Steven Afternoon Steven Difficult to tell much over the internet but I would start with the battery cable connections, make sure the connection are clean & make sure they are tight. Otherwise, if you can hone in on an area on your motorcycle where the popping is coming from we can define whet to look for a little better. Why did you replace the battery? This info might also help us help you. Link to comment
steve68 Posted September 20, 2023 Author Share Posted September 20, 2023 If pressed I would say the sound comes from under the RHS of the fuel tank (if seated on the bike). and the wisps of smoke seem to come up from under that right side as well. I had gotten a new battery as the crappy battery I had bought at a local battery place 2 years ago was clearly petering out. Link to comment

Afternoon Steven There is a wire harness running from the under the tank to the handlebars, there is a red wire in that harness that has a habit of failing close to the zip tie that retains the harness. It's possible that wire is broken inside the insulation then just making a partial connection. Start the engine then turn the handlebars back & forth to see is the engine falters or the gauges quit. Also check the battery cables for being tight at the battery posts (especially if the problem started after the new battery change. Link to comment
